Trade Union LAW AND LEGAL
Definition:

A combination or as-soclation of men employed in the same trade, (Usually a manual or mechanical trade,) unlt-ed for the purpose of regulatlng the customs and- standards of their trade, fixing prices or hours of labor, influencing the relations ef employer and employed, enlarging or main-tainlng their rights and privileges, and other similar ■ objects

trade union ENGLISH
Definition:

An organized combination among workmen for the purpose
of maintaining their rights, privileges, and interests with respect to
wages, hours of labor, customs, etc.
